Output 51c5c9e8244756d3609553335bdb9398b53e67325d3b219d8288aab6f3b48396:1

value
967054514
script pubkey
OP_0 OP_PUSHBYTES_20 bd4a68a3dceca0361ea95a21c36c35635926748d
address
bc1qh49x3g7uajsrv84ftgsuxmp4vdvjvaydkw0n7f
transaction
51c5c9e8244756d3609553335bdb9398b53e67325d3b219d8288aab6f3b48396
confirmations
360996
spent
true